DBA Data[Home] [Help]

PACKAGE: APPS.IEX_CO_WF

Source


1 PACKAGE IEX_CO_WF AUTHID CURRENT_USER AS
2 /* $Header: IEXRCOWS.pls 120.0 2004/01/24 03:15:18 appldev noship $ */
3 
4   ---------------------------------------------------------------------------
5   -- GLOBAL MESSAGE CONSTANTS
6   ---------------------------------------------------------------------------
7   G_FND_APP		      CONSTANT VARCHAR2(200) := okl_api.G_FND_APP;
8   G_INVALID_VALUE	      CONSTANT VARCHAR2(200) := okl_api.G_INVALID_VALUE;
9   G_COL_NAME_TOKEN	      CONSTANT VARCHAR2(200) := 'COL_NAME';
10   G_COL_NAME1_TOKEN	      CONSTANT VARCHAR2(200) := 'COL_NAME1';
11   G_COL_NAME2_TOKEN	      CONSTANT VARCHAR2(200) := 'COL_NAME2';
12   G_PARENT_TABLE_TOKEN	      CONSTANT VARCHAR2(200) := 'PARENT_TABLE';
13   G_UNEXPECTED_ERROR          CONSTANT VARCHAR2(200) := 'IEX_UNEXPECTED_ERROR';
14   G_SQLERRM_TOKEN             CONSTANT VARCHAR2(200) := 'SQLERRM';
15   G_SQLCODE_TOKEN             CONSTANT VARCHAR2(200) := 'SQLCODE';
16 
17   ---------------------------------------------------------------------------
18   -- GLOBAL VARIABLES
19   ---------------------------------------------------------------------------
20   G_PKG_NAME		      CONSTANT VARCHAR2(200) := 'IEX_CO_WF';
21   G_APP_NAME		      CONSTANT VARCHAR2(3)   :=  'IEX';
22 
23   ---------------------------------------------------------------------------
24   -- GLOBAL EXCEPTION
25   ---------------------------------------------------------------------------
26   G_EXCEPTION_HALT_VALIDATION	EXCEPTION;
27 
28 
29   ---------------------------------------------------------------------------
30   -- GLOBAL VARIABLES
31   ---------------------------------------------------------------------------
32   wf_yes      varchar2(1) := 'Y';
33   wf_no       varchar2(1) := 'N';
34 
35   ---------------------------------------------------------------------------
36   -- Procedures and Functions
37   ---------------------------------------------------------------------------
38 
39   /*Send notification to customer about intent to report to credit bureau*/
40   PROCEDURE notify_customer(itemtype        in varchar2,
41                             itemkey         in varchar2,
42                             actid           in number,
43                             funcmode        in varchar2,
44                             resultout       out NOCOPY varchar2);
45 
46 
47   /*report customer to the credit bureau*/
48   PROCEDURE report_customer(itemtype        in varchar2,
49                             itemkey         in varchar2,
50                             actid           in number,
51                             funcmode        in varchar2,
52                             resultout       out NOCOPY varchar2);
53 
54   /*transfers case to external agency*/
55   PROCEDURE transfer_case(itemtype        in varchar2,
56                             itemkey         in varchar2,
57                             actid           in number,
58                             funcmode        in varchar2,
59                             resultout       out NOCOPY varchar2);
60 
61   /*review case transfer*/
62   PROCEDURE review_case(itemtype        in varchar2,
63                             itemkey         in varchar2,
64                             actid           in number,
65                             funcmode        in varchar2,
66                             resultout       out NOCOPY varchar2);
67 
68   /*review case transfer*/
69   PROCEDURE recall_case(itemtype        in varchar2,
70                             itemkey         in varchar2,
71                             actid           in number,
72                             funcmode        in varchar2,
73                             resultout       out NOCOPY varchar2);
74 
75   /** send signal to the main work flow that the custom work flow is over and
76   * also updates the work item
77   **/
78   PROCEDURE wf_send_signal_cancelled(itemtype    in   varchar2,
79                            itemkey     in   varchar2,
80                            actid       in   number,
81                            funcmode    in   varchar2,
82                            result      out NOCOPY  varchar2);
83 
84   /** send signal to the main work flow that the custom work flow is over and
85   * also updates the work item
86   **/
87   PROCEDURE wf_send_signal_complete(itemtype    in   varchar2,
88                            itemkey     in   varchar2,
89                            actid       in   number,
90                            funcmode    in   varchar2,
91                            result      out NOCOPY  varchar2);
92 
93 
94   --PROCEDURE raise_report_cb_event(p_delinquency_id IN NUMBER);
95 
96 END IEX_CO_WF;